NU nursing grads continue to excel on national licensing exam
GeneralSchool of NursingGraduates at Nipissing University’s School of Nursing continue to excel, with the newly released 2024 Nursing Registration Exams Report from the College of Nurses of Ontario (CNO) once again highlighting Nipissing as a top-performing institution in the province. The report shows that 96% of Nipissing's nursing graduates passed their registration exams on their first attempt, a result that surpasses the provincial average and affirms the program’s reputation for excellence. -

Nipissing University, Cambrian College professor wins national award
GeneralSchool of NursingOnly ten people a year receive this award in Canada, and Laura Killam of Cambrian College in Sudbury and Nipissing University of North Bay is one of them. Killam, a faculty member in both Cambrian’s and Nipissing’s Schools of Nursing, has been chosen as one of the 2023 recipients of a 3M National Teaching Fellowship. -
Nursing prof recognized with Pat Griffin Research Grant
GeneralSchool of NursingResearchThe Canadian Association of Schools of Nursing (CASN) has announced that Dr. Sandra Goldsworthy, professor in Nipissing University’s School of Nursing, is one of the recipients of the Pat Griffin Research Grants and $15,000 in funding. The Pat Griffin Research Grant supports research with a priority of “Nursing Education Outcomes” from the National Research Priorities for Nursing. -
NU instructor receives CASN Nursing Education Excellence Award
School of NursingGeneralThe Canadian Association of Schools of Nursing (CASN) has announced that Laura Killam is the recipient of the 2022 CASN Nursing Education Excellence (Non-Tenured) Award. Killam is a part-time instructor at Nipissing University in the Registered Practical Nurse to Bachelor of Science in Nursing program. She was presented with this award on Monday, November 21 at CASN’s virtual Awards Recognition Event. -

Celebrating National Nursing Week
School of NursingMay 6-12 marks National Nursing Week, an annual celebration that takes place the week of Florence Nightingale’s birthday, May 12. This year's theme, #WeAnswerTheCall, showcases the many roles that nurses play in a patient’s health-care journey. The pandemic has highlighted the courage and commitment that nurses exhibit every day and the important role they play in the community.
